查询MySQL数据库密码通常不是直接可行的,因为出于安全考虑,密码是以加密形式存储的。但是,如果你忘记了密码或者需要重置密码,可以按照以下步骤操作:
重置MySQL密码步骤:
- 停止MySQL服务:
在Linux系统中,可以使用以下命令停止MySQL服务:
- 停止MySQL服务:
在Linux系统中,可以使用以下命令停止MySQL服务:
- 或者
- 或者
- 启动MySQL服务,跳过权限表:
使用以下命令启动MySQL服务,并跳过权限验证:
- 启动MySQL服务,跳过权限表:
使用以下命令启动MySQL服务,并跳过权限验证:
- 或者在某些系统中:
- 或者在某些系统中:
- 登录MySQL:
打开一个新的终端窗口,输入以下命令登录MySQL:
- 登录MySQL:
打开一个新的终端窗口,输入以下命令登录MySQL:
- 重置密码:
在MySQL命令行中,执行以下SQL语句来重置root用户的密码:
- 重置密码:
在MySQL命令行中,执行以下SQL语句来重置root用户的密码:
- 将
new_password
替换为你想要设置的新密码。 - 重启MySQL服务:
停止跳过权限表的MySQL实例,并重新启动正常的MySQL服务:
- 重启MySQL服务:
停止跳过权限表的MySQL实例,并重新启动正常的MySQL服务:
- 或者
- 或者
- 验证新密码:
使用新密码尝试登录MySQL:
- 验证新密码:
使用新密码尝试登录MySQL:
- 输入新密码,如果能够成功登录,说明密码已经成功重置。
注意事项:
- 在执行这些操作时,确保你有足够的权限。
- 如果你在生产环境中操作,请确保在维护窗口期间进行,以避免对用户造成影响。
- 重置密码后,建议检查并更新任何依赖于旧密码的应用程序或脚本。
参考链接:
通过上述步骤,你可以重置MySQL数据库的密码,而不是直接查询它。这是出于安全考虑的标准做法。